linux基礎vim命令

2021-08-10 06:48:00 字數 1414 閱讀 6527

編輯器、伺服器

vi編輯器

yy複製 p 貼上

命令列模式—–>i—–>插入模式 —-> esc—->命令列模式

命令列模式—–>:—–>末行模式 —-> esc—->命令列模式

vim編輯器基礎操作

1 從命令列到插入模式:

i : 游標前插入

a :游標後插入

i :行首插入

a :行末插入

o:游標下一行行首

o:游標上一行行首

o i i 游標 a a

o

2末行模式:

w 儲存

q 退出

x 儲存並退出

3進入命令列模式:

`esc:從插入模式或末行模式進入命令模式

yy複製,,,,,,

3 yy 複製3行

p貼上

4移動游標:

h j k l:對應左下上右

g: 定位到檔案最後一行

6 g :快速定位到第6行

gg:定位到檔案開頭

5刪除命令:

x:刪除游標後的乙個字元del

x:刪除游標前的乙個字元backspace

dd:刪除游標所在行,剪下,可以配合p貼上使用

n dd :刪除指定的行數

d0:刪除游標本行所有內容,不包含游標所在字元

dw:刪除游標開始位置的字,包含游標所在字元

d:刪除游標本行所在所有內容,包括游標所在字元

6撤銷命令:

u:一步一步撤銷

ctr-r:反撤銷

7可視模式:

文字行右移:>>

文字行左移:<<

v:按字元移動,選中文字

v:按行移動,配合d,y,>>,《實現對文字塊的刪除,複製,左右移動

8替換操作:

r:替換當前字元

r:替換當前行游標後的字元

9查詢命令:

10替換命令:

將abc替換為123

末行模式下,將游標所在行的abc替換為123: % s/abc/123/g

末行模式下,將1-10行的abc替換為123: 1,10s/abc/123/g

Linux基礎 vim命令

簡介 vim是從 vi 發展出來的乙個文字編輯器。補完 編譯及錯誤跳轉等方便程式設計的功能特別豐富,在程式設計師中被廣泛使用。vi vim 共分為三種模式,分別是命令模式 command mode 也叫一般模式,輸入 編輯模式 insert mode 和底線命令模式 last line mode 模...

Linux基礎命令Vim 二

b 進入 vi filename a 在游標後 a 在本行末 i 在游標前 i 在本行開始 o 在游標下 o 在游標上 定位 移至行尾 0 移至行首 數字零 h 移至螢幕上端 m 移至螢幕 l 移至螢幕下端 上下左右 h 向左 j 向下 k 向上 l 向右 set nu 設定行號 set nonu ...

linux常用基礎命令 vim

vim是從vi發展出來的乙個文字編輯器。補全 編譯及錯誤跳轉等方便程式設計的功能特別豐富。因此,學習vim的使用方法是很有必要的。vim的工作模式 vim一般有6種工作模式。普通模式 使用vim開啟乙個檔案時預設模式,也叫命令模式,允許使用者通過各種命令瀏覽 滾屏等操作。命令列模式 在普通模式下,先...